• DocumentCode
    2750373
  • Title

    A methodology and environment for the object oriented analysis and design of real time systems

  • Author

    Baldassari, Marco ; Bruno, Giorgio

  • Author_Institution
    Dipartimento di Autom. e Inf., Politecnico di Torino, Italy
  • fYear
    1990
  • fDate
    6-8 Jun 1990
  • Firstpage
    72
  • Lastpage
    78
  • Abstract
    PROTOB, a methodology based on an object-oriented formalism for the executable specification of event-driven systems is presented. The PROTOB formalism integrates and extends SA/RT dataflows and Petri nets. PROTOB applies the operational paradigm to the software life cycle: its software models are executable and directly translatable into C or Ada code. It is supported by a fully tested CASE (computer-aided software engineering) environment which consists of several tools supporting specification, modeling, simulation, and prototyping activities. As its major application area, PROTOB addresses the object-oriented analysis and design of large-scale, event-driven systems such as real-time embedded systems, communication protocols, distributed systems, and automated manufacturing control systems. An example of its application is presented. The automatic generation of the whole code of an embedded system running on a Motorola 68000 chip has been performed by the supporting CASE tool
  • Keywords
    Petri nets; object-oriented programming; programming environments; real-time systems; Ada; C; CASE; PROTOB; Petri nets; SA/RT dataflows; design; environment; methodology; modeling; object oriented analysis; operational paradigm; prototyping; real time systems; simulation; software life cycle; specification; Application software; Computational modeling; Computer aided software engineering; Computer simulation; Embedded system; Object oriented modeling; Petri nets; Software prototyping; Software testing; Virtual prototyping;
  • fLanguage
    English
  • Publisher
    ieee
  • Conference_Titel
    Real Time, 1990. Proceedings., Euromicro '90 Workshop on
  • Conference_Location
    Horsholm
  • Print_ISBN
    0-8186-2076-5
  • Type

    conf

  • DOI
    10.1109/EMWRT.1990.128231
  • Filename
    128231